TWO goals apiece from Robin van Persie and Danny Welbeck guided Manchester United to their first Premier League victory of the David Moyes era, as they ran out 4-1 winners at Swansea.
Wilfried Bony’s second-half strike was the only blight on Moyes’ evening, with his side going straight to the top of the table.
But it was the hosts who first had the ball in the back of the net, as Michu lashed the ball home from close range, only to see the flag raised against Nathan Dyer.
The visitors nearly capitalised on the let-off immediately through Van Persie, but the Dutchman dragged his effort wide before David De Gea was called upon to pull off a fine save from Swans new-boy Jonjo Shelvy.
Van Persie broke the deadlock as he latched on to Giggs’ lofted pass to impressively hook the ball home, before Danny Welbeck slotted home a simple tap-in following Antonio Valencia’s driven cross.
There were half-chances for both sides early in the second-half, without either goalkeeper really being put to the test.
Wayne Rooney, subject of strong summer speculation linking him with a move to Chelsea, was introduced to the action 15 minutes into the half, with Giggs making way.
But it was Van Persie who added to the scoreline in the 72nd-minute, after he picked up the ball midway into the Swans’ half, before dancing past two defenders to fire into the top corner from the edge of the box.
Swansea debutant Wilfried Bony hit a well-worked consolation strike for the hosts with eight minutes remaining.
